We went to a presentation about the Mormon Battalion that was an active military unit during the Mexican-American War.
It is the only battalion named after a religious group. I grew up learning about Israel Evans who walked the 2,000 miles in Company B.
Before we went, we looked up on Family Search to see if Sweetheart had a member of the battalion. He did. His name was Riley Garner Clark and was in Company A.
Hurricane liked the brass band that was there. The only battle that they fought was against bulls south of Tucson.
